29th Intermodal Africa 2023 Exhibition and Conference : Accelerating Sustainable Transitions

The 29th Intermodal Africa 2023 Exhibition and Conference will take place from Tuesday 18 to Thursday 20 April at the Durban International Convention Centre hosted by Transnet National Ports Authority and officially endorsed by the Port Management Association of Eastern and Southern Africa (PMAESA) and the Association of Indian Ocean Islands Ports (L’Association des ports des îles de l’océan Indien (APIOI).

The 29th Intermodal Africa 2023 Exhibition and Conference has “Accelerating Sustainable Transitions” as its main theme, and it is poised to host seven sessions covering a broad range of topics related to the transportation and logistics sector. The sessions include :

  • Essential Evolution of Containerisation and its Impact on the African Economy,
  • Managing Safety Risks in Transportation and Logistics Industry,
  • Analysing Operational Challenges Facing African Ports and Terminals,
  • Optimising the Effectiveness of Intermodal Transport Systems in Africa,
  • Unlocking African Investments by Building Partnerships and Creating Opportunities through the Land, Sea, and Rail Sectors,
  • The Key Factors Influencing African Sustainable Economic Development in Integrated Global Green Economy,
  • Transportation and Logistics Industry transformation through Automation, Digitalisation, and Artificial Intelligence.

On the programme, on Tuesday 18 April, for all pre-registered delegates, there will be a comprehensive Technical Site Visit to Durban Port and a lively evening Business Networking Reception arranged by Transnet National Ports Authority for all pre-registered participants.

On Wednesday 19 and Thursday 20 April, a two days Conference Programme will feature 35 world-class transportation and logistics conference speakers addressing topical issues and challenges on global and regional trade and investment attended by a gathering of 350 senior government officials, industry principals, academics, senior executive harbour masters, harbour engineers, port engineers, maintenance supervisors and procurement decision makers together with the region’s leading shippers, cargo owners, importers / exporters, shipping lines, freight forwarders, logistics companies, ports, terminal operating companies, railway operators, port equipment and services suppliers from countries throughout Europe, Middle East and Africa (EMEA).

There will be the commercial opportunity for 50 exhibitors and sponsors to network with the delegates at this major annual international maritime transport Exhibition and Conference trade event for Africa.

On Wednesday 19 April, for all pre-registered delegates, there will also be an elaborate Business Networking Dinner in a relaxed but professional atmosphere hosted by Transnet National Ports Authority for all pre-registered participants.
